
Organised by the Faculty of Arts, and co-organised by the Morningside College, Department of English and English Language Teaching Unit, we are delighted to announce the CUHK Poetry Contest 2025, a highlight of the upcoming CUHK Artist-in-Residence Programme! All CUHK undergraduate and postgraduate students enrolled for the 2025–26 academic year are invited to join this exciting event.
This year, we are honoured to have invited Professor Forrest Gander, Pulitzer Prize-winning poet, author and translator, as CUHK’s 2025 Artist-in-Residence and the guest judge for the Poetry Contest.
